Next high Spring Tide at North Sarasota will be on Thu 25 Apr (height: …Red tides have been documented along Florida's gulf coast since the 1840’s. The Florida red tide organism, Karenia brevis, produces a toxin that may kill marine animals and affect humans. In the Gulf of Mexico, some harmful algal blooms are caused by the microscopic algae species Karenia brevis, commonly called red tide. These algal blooms can cause respiratory illness and eye irritation in humans. It can also kill marine life, and lead to shellfish closures. Blooms are often patchy, so impacts vary by beach and throughout the day. Health Alert for Sarasota County. As stubborn and patchy red tide lingers off Sarasota and Manatee counties, experts are keeping a close eye on changes in ocean currents for signs of a new bloom that could make matters ...The College of Marine Science, University of South Florida (CMS-USF) provides seasonal predictions of major red tide events and short-term tracking of red tide once an event occurs. Seasonal prediction follows from the recognition that Karenia brevis red tide, of offshore origin, thrives under the low nutrient conditions generally found in the middle of …
